I've been having trouble setting time aside to study for the CSET and have been feeling overwhelmed. WebThe CSET is graded on a pass/fail basis by individual subtests. The score range for a subtest is from 100 to 300, and a score of 220 is considered a passing score on every subtest. In order to pass a given CSET test, you will need to pass each of the required individual subtests. This means you are not given a numeric score for your overall ... WebApr 9, 2024 · 9.)
